In 1805, Clarissa Alexander entered the world in Mecklenburg, North Carolina, United States, born to William Alexander And Mary Henderson. Clarissa Alexander married James Harper Kerns, and had children including Sarah E Kerns. Clarissa Alexander passed away in 1845 in Mecklenburg, North Carolina, United States.
